Three faced depiction[edit]

The three headed person is the Anti-christ of the Dianic cult in medieval European art. This is not an allusion to the "wide range of his dealings" and is not unusual. Satan was often depicted as a three headed demon (a parody of the Holy Trinity) in the European Medieval tradition - cf Dante's Inferno, and Florence's baptistry mosaics etc.
